How do working adults schedule their regular sessions? by rebent in rpg

[–]Shadowrose 4 points5 points  (0 children)

If your group cannot commit to a consistent meeting time, I would consider playing an episode-esque game where each session is unique to itself and doesn't require a continual plot line. This allows people to attend as they can and would likely allow you to play more games, more often.

Two other alternatives are doing a West Marches style sandbox game, or a Living City style game. West Marches tends to be super plot-light, and allows as large of a rotating cast as you like. Living City can do all the plot you want. Characters just happen to be busy doing Something Else (TM) when the player's absent.

What do you guys do to cut back on gas usage besides getting a car with better mpg? by Steveatron1 in Frugal

[–]Shadowrose 1 point2 points  (0 children)

You know, there's one thing Mr. Money Mustache overlooks there. Walking or Bicycling to work just shifts your commuting costs from driving to eating. Bicycling consumes 30-50+ calories per mile. Food costs anywhere from 350 calories per dollar to 1,000+ calories per dollar. If you assume 50 calories/mile (low for walking, high for bicycling), and 500 calories/$, you're still spending $0.10/mile. Certainly less than the vehicle costs, but not quite so dramatically.
